Output 333844896f8b68475ccc051bc544afd5cba0dc75abba8e6896b7113414abc26e:0

value
83622325
script pubkey
OP_0 OP_PUSHBYTES_20 2eb2e4d6f2a53964a0962fb7ce2f6bcecd4b119e
address
tb1q96ewf4hj55ukfgyk97muutmtemx5kyv7xtetan
transaction
333844896f8b68475ccc051bc544afd5cba0dc75abba8e6896b7113414abc26e